I meant

stats=true&stats.field=price&stats.facet=category

2012/2/6 Johannes Goll <johannes.g...@gmail.com>:
> you can use the StatsComponent
>
> http://wiki.apache.org/solr/StatsComponent
>
> with stats=true&stats.price=category&stats.facet=category
>
> and pull the sum fields from the resulting stats facets.
>
> Johannes
>
> 2012/2/5 Paul Kapla <paul.ka...@gmail.com>:
>> Hi everyone,
>> I'm pretty new to solr and I'm not sure if this can even be done. Is there
>> a way to sum a specific field per each item in a facet. For example, you
>> have an ecommerce site that has the following documents:
>>
>> id,category,name,price
>> 1,books,'solr book', $10.00
>> 2,books,'lucene in action', $12.00
>> 3.video, 'cool video', $20.00
>>
>> so instead of getting (when faceting on category)
>> books(2)
>> video(1)
>>
>> I'd like to get:
>> books ($22)
>> video ($20)
>>
>> Is this something that can be even done? Any feedback would be much
>> appreciated.
